Transaction 50be4242c3dacc7e3cece8e13a822da83e96e7a2c709dd34cbbd31f37aea5dd7

1 Input
2 Outputs
  • 50be4242c3dacc7e3cece8e13a822da83e96e7a2c709dd34cbbd31f37aea5dd7:0
  • value  1257958
    address  33qrs5NVjfEPbKQf4XWwAUnkpcbuYWEmt6
  • 50be4242c3dacc7e3cece8e13a822da83e96e7a2c709dd34cbbd31f37aea5dd7:1
  • value  25057814
    address  18XfzwmPiXTdRXc3KPRL7mX5nScNaHymz5